Ingredients

To make these delightful Cinnamon Roll Bliss Bars, you’ll need the following ingredients:

For the Base

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For the Cinnamon Filling

  • ½ cup brown sugar, packed
  • ½ cup chopped pecans or walnuts (optional)

How to Make Cinnamon Roll Bliss Bars

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13 in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per to prevent sticking.

Step 2: Mix Dry Ingredients

In a bowl, combine the following:
* 2 cups all-purpose flour
* 1 cup granulated sugar
* 1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
* 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Stir until blended.

Step 3: Combine Wet Ingredients

In another bowl, mix together:
* ½ cup melted unsalted butter
* 2 large eggs
* 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Whisk until well combined.

Step 4: Create the Batter

Add the wet mixture to the dry ingredients. Mix until just combined—do not overmix.

Step 5: Prepare the Cinnamon Filling

In a separate bowl, combine:
* ½ cup brown sugar
* 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Step 6: Assemble the Bars

Spread half of the batter into the prepared baking pan. Sprinkle half of the cinnamon mixture over this layer. Dollop remaining batter on top and sprinkle with the rest of the cinnamon mixture. Gently swirl with a knife to create a marbled effect.

Step 7: Bake

Place in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es until golden brown and set in the middle. Enjoy your delicious Cinnamon Roll Bliss Bars!

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store your Cinnamon Roll Bliss Bars in an airtight container.
  • They will stay fresh for up to three days in the refrigerator.

Freezing Cinnamon Roll Bliss Bars

  • Wrap individual bars t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il before placing them in a freezer-safe bag.
  • They can be frozen for up to three months. Just remember to label them with the date!

Reheating Cinnamon Roll Bliss Bars

  •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C). Place bars on a baking sheet and warm for about 10 minutes.
  • Microwave: Heat one bar at a time on medium power for 15-20 seconds until warm.
  • Stovetop: Place a bar in a skillet over low heat, cover, and warm for about 5 minutes.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 cup brown sugar, packed
  • ½ cup chopped pecans or walnuts (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13 in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, and ground cinnamon.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together melted butter, eggs,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  4. Mix the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ients until just combined.
  5. For the filling, mix brown sugar and ground cinnamon in a separate bowl.
  6. Spread half of the batter in the prepared pan. Sprinkle half of the filling over it. Add dollops of remaining batter on top, followed by the rest of the filling. Swirl gently with a knife to marble.
  7. Bake for 25-30 minutes until golden brown and set in the middle.
